summ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André Fabian Silva Delgado <emulatorman@parabola.nu>2014-08-29 08:27:48 -0300
committerAndré Fabian Silva Delgado <emulatorman@parabola.nu>2014-08-29 08:27:48 -0300
commit667a4fed4e16fe3279c075e538947537b4fdf701 (patch)
tree79a1bc1c057a5bac7eb7caa3264119429a3b8822
parent8969339d1c5b16277dadef458e97f7e16c7b055c (diff)
texlive-core-libre-2014.34872-1: updating version
-rw-r--r--libre/texlive-core-libre/PKGBUILD37
-rw-r--r--libre/texlive-core-libre/texlive-core.maps5
2 files changed, 30 insertions, 12 deletions
diff --git a/libre/texlive-core-libre/PKGBUILD b/libre/texlive-core-libre/PKGBUILD
index a5455426c..b66db3c34 100644
--- a/libre/texlive-core-libre/PKGBUILD
+++ b/libre/texlive-core-libre/PKGBUILD
@@ -4,21 +4,23 @@
pkgname=texlive-core-libre
_pkgname=texlive-core
-pkgver=2013.33063
-_revnr=${pkgver#2013.}
+pkgver=2014.34872
+_revnr=${pkgver#2014.}
pkgrel=1
pkgdesc="TeX Live core distribution, without nonfree add-on packages (Parabola rebranded)"
license=('GPL')
arch=(any)
depends=('texlive-bin' 'perl')
optdepends=(
- 'ruby: for old ConTeXT MkII and epspdf'
- 'perl-tk: for texdoctk'
- 'python2: for dviasm'
+ 'dialog: for texconfig'
'ghostscript: for epstopdf, epspdf and other ConTeXt tools'
+ 'java-runtime: for utilities like arara'
+ 'perl-tk: for texdoctk'
'psutils: to manipulate the output of dvips'
+ 'python: for pythontex'
+ 'python2: for dviasm'
+ 'ruby: for old ConTeXT MkII and epspdf'
't1utils: can be useful when installing Type1 fonts'
- 'jre7-openjdk: for utilities like arara'
)
groups=('texlive-most')
conflicts=('tetex' 'texlive-latex3' 'texlive-core')
@@ -32,7 +34,6 @@ source=("https://repo.parabolagnulinux.org/other/$pkgname/$pkgname-$pkgver-src.t
"texmf.cnf"
"texmfcnf.lua"
"09-texlive-fonts.conf")
-options=(!strip)
install=texlive.install
backup=(etc/texmf/web2c/texmf.cnf \
etc/texmf/chktex/chktexrc \
@@ -45,10 +46,9 @@ backup=(etc/texmf/web2c/texmf.cnf \
etc/texmf/web2c/fmtutil.cnf \
etc/texmf/web2c/mktex.cnf \
etc/texmf/xdvi/XDvi)
-
-mkmd5sums=('7e11e1bf401d0a152ac50ef48d676bb3')
-md5sums=('7f276d14c0d715704b1acbc195e72fe6'
- '8b998b0944a766abeb1ff8ca53029084'
+mkmd5sums=('65e63bdefdc909b9d6e6624924e53feb')
+md5sums=('016626916175b074e98b6f1aa9fa9ff7'
+ '75c813acb5df57d174e4bd07019adf34'
'd5a3f442ec3b7aa1518170f64f9d006b'
'16ad4dc53deb00029baef1b01ba1d984'
'393a4bf67adc7ca5df2b386759d1a637')
@@ -180,9 +180,14 @@ package() {
mkdir -p "${pkgdir}/usr/bin"
bash "${pkgdir}"/usr/share/texmf-dist/scripts/texlive/texlinks.sh -f "$pkgdir"/usr/share/texmf-dist/web2c/fmtutil.cnf "$pkgdir"/usr/bin/
- # use python2 for dviasm
+ # use python2 instead of python for scripts.
+ sed -i '1s/python/python2/' $pkgdir/usr/share/texmf-dist/scripts/de-macro/de-macro
sed -i 's/env python/env python2/' $pkgdir/usr/share/texmf-dist/scripts/dviasm/dviasm.py
+ # install Perl libraries
+ mv "$pkgdir"/usr/share/texmf-dist/tlpkg "$pkgdir"/usr/share
+ rm -rf "$pkgdir"/usr/share/tlpkg/tlpobj
+
# copy config file to texmf-config
#mkdir -p $pkgdir/etc/texmf/tex/context/config
#cp -a $pkgdir/usr/share/texmf-dist/tex/context/config/cont-usr.tex \
@@ -214,9 +219,11 @@ chktex/chkweb.sh
chktex/deweb.pl
context/perl/mptopdf.pl
context/stubs/unix/context
+context/stubs/unix/contextjit
context/stubs/unix/ctxtools
context/stubs/unix/luatools
context/stubs/unix/mtxrun
+context/stubs/unix/mtxrunjit
context/stubs/unix/pstopdf
context/stubs/unix/texexec
context/stubs/unix/texmfstart
@@ -233,14 +240,17 @@ fontools/autoinst
fontools/ot2kpx
fragmaster/fragmaster.pl
installfont/installfont-tl
+latex-git-log/latex-git-log
latex2man/latex2man
latexdiff/latexdiff-vc.pl
latexdiff/latexdiff.pl
latexdiff/latexrevise.pl
latexfileversion/latexfileversion
+latexindent/latexindent.pl
latexmk/latexmk.pl
latexpand/latexpand
ltxfileinfo/ltxfileinfo
+ltximg/ltximg.pl
lua2dox/lua2dox_filter
luaotfload/luaotfload-tool.lua
match_parens/match_parens
@@ -266,6 +276,8 @@ pkfix-helper/pkfix-helper
pkfix/pkfix.pl
ps2eps/ps2eps.pl
purifyeps/purifyeps
+pythontex/pythontex.py
+pythontex/depythontex.py
simpdftex/simpdftex
sty2dtx/sty2dtx.pl
texcount/texcount.pl
@@ -274,6 +286,7 @@ texdiff/texdiff
texdirflatten/texdirflatten
texdoc/texdoc.tlu
texdoctk/texdoctk.pl
+texfot/texfot.pl
texlive/allcm.sh
texlive/allneeded.sh
texlive/dvi2fax.sh
diff --git a/libre/texlive-core-libre/texlive-core.maps b/libre/texlive-core-libre/texlive-core.maps
index 46f598907..8cb9a9689 100644
--- a/libre/texlive-core-libre/texlive-core.maps
+++ b/libre/texlive-core-libre/texlive-core.maps
@@ -2,11 +2,14 @@ Map euler.map
Map charter.map
Map cs-charter.map
Map csfonts.map
+Map dummy-space.map
Map fpls.map
+Map garuda-c90.map
Map l7x-urwvn.map
Map lm.map
Map marvosym.map
Map mathpple.map
+Map norasi-c90.map
Map original-context-symbol.map
Map pazo.map
Map pxfonts.map
@@ -32,6 +35,8 @@ Map utm.map
Map utopia.map
Map uzc.map
Map uzd.map
+MixedMap arss.map
+MixedMap artm.map
MixedMap ccpl.map
MixedMap cm-super-t1.map
MixedMap cm-super-t2a.map